Connect to a server by using ssh on linux or mac os x. To use it, goto finder, and selext go utilities from the top menu. For the longest time, a couple of the more popular choices have been cygwin and putty these still work today but i personally find the experience of both to be suboptimal. Teamcity ssh agent uses a native ssh agent from the openssh included with linux and mac os x, so the feature works out of the box for these oss. The builtin ssh client on windows, however, forces you to use a. Normally you have a fullyfledged programming language that sometimes runs a command being ssh client, and universal one. Every once in a while i hear of windows users trying to find a good ssh client for windows to connect to their linux boxes. Do you know that you can use gcc to build windows executables and dlls from linux, mac, or wsl. If ssh asdfasdf says connection refused rather than some variant.
Create a passwordless ssh connection between mac osx and a remote computer using private and public keys generated without passwords and store in authorised keys. Putty is open source software that is available with source code and is developed and supported by a group of volunteers. These commands allow you to do such things as log into a server, download files, and manage files on your computer or a web server. It also discusses generating an ssh key and adding a public key to the server. Cygwin is also called an emulator because it translates linux system calls into windows type systems calls. It provides a bash shell, autotools, revision control systems and the like for building native windows. Any other ssh client will render the remote server at whatever size the local client window is. Use ssh and xming to display x programs from a linux computer on a windows computer. Users of telnet, rlogin, and ftp may not realize that their password is transmitted across the internet unencrypted, but it is. At its core is an independent rewrite of msys, based on modern cygwin posix compatibility layer and mingww64 with the aim of better interoperability with native windows software. It can act as a client for the ssh, telnet, rlogin, and raw tcp computing protocols and as a serial console client. If no response comes, then it will keep trying the above process till 10 serveralivecountmax times 600 seconds.
You can install a program like cygwin or mingw to get ssh functionality. Msys is a collection of gnu utilities such as bash, make, gawk and grep to allow building of applications and programs which depend on traditionally unix tools to be present. The cygwin mailing lists are the places for all questions. Putty is a free opensource terminal emulator which lets you initiate interactive commandline sessions to uits unix servers. Install openssh server on windows a list of ssh client on windows this entry was posted in computer tips and tagged mingw, ssh, ssh client by admin. Some hard to find emulations on a mac, like tn3270, tn5250, or qnx. Openssh is a cost free version of the ssh protocol suite. Ssh stands for secure shell, and it permits making encrypted connections into other computers over a network or the broader internet. Cygwin and putty run in separate console experiences. Cygwin is free software to provide linux and unix environment, tools and libraries in windows operating systems. Download putty a free ssh and telnet client for windows.
However, there are many options for ssh clients for mac, and this page discusses several of them. Hey guys, im kind of new to this and need the mingw compiler on qt creator for a school project, the problem is that i use mac. For example, on a windows vista installation, this would be done by issuing setx home c. I know that ssh from the command line is easy enough, but would like to give my students that use os x a gui option. It is fully featured, small and fast, simple to install and because it is standalone native microsoft windows, easily made portable not needing a machinespecific installation. A clientside ssh2 implementation for executing commands and shell sessions on unixwindows ssh servers, and an sftp implementation for file transfer and remote file management over ssh. Many of the users who utilize telnet, ftp, rlogin and other programs may not realize that their passwords are transmitted in plain text unencrypted across the internet. Openssh for mac os x installation, how to and custom packages. I downloaded the the brew files using terminal but i dont seem to be able to find mingww64 is my applications, although it appears as already installed on terminal. How to install and use cygwin with terminal and ssh. Address space is a very limiting factor for cygwin. How to connect to a windows pc from a mac os x terminal super.
Microsoft adds an openssh client to windows 10 hacker news. After youve checked for existing ssh keys, you can generate a new ssh key to use. Putty ssh client for mac osx download and tutorial. How to prevent a background process from being stopped after closing ssh client in linux. Lets walk through how to make an ssh connection into another computer using the native ssh client in mac os. Terminus is not a new shell or a mingw or cygwin replacement. An example would be building a library that uses the autotools build system. Putty is an ssh client for windows, byt there is no putty for mac.
Using the builtin ssh client shipped with git for windows, you need to set up the home environment variable so that the git ssh client can find the key. Mingw minimalistic gnu for windows is a port of the gnu compiler. Cyberduck is a fairly popular file transfer client for apple mac and microsoft windows. The client program is primarily for logging in and executing commands from the credentials stage. Zoc is a professional and advanced ssh, terminal emulator and telnet client for windows and mac os x operating systems. Connecting from unixlike environment linux, mac os x. Check ssh keys management for ssh key upload notes agent setup. Connecting from unixlike environment linux, mac os x, cygwinmingw. Use ssh and xming to display x programs from a linux. It made my day and fixed the issue with git provided that your. An ssh client is an application on your computer you use to run shell commands. If you dont do this your ssh client will refuse to use the key giving an error which. Well, you can install an x server, and enable ssh tunneling with your ssh client, and oneup.
The code handles the layer 2 udp connection and mndp discovery portion of the mac telnet protocol to allow tunneling ssh connections to an ssh enabled mac telnet server. The ssh agent build feature, runs an ssh agent with the selected uploaded ssh key during a build. Builtin ssh client support for ftp multiple terminal autoimport of putty sessions rdp functionality rdp sessions in a tab. Putty is an ssh and telnet client, developed originally by simon tatham for the windows platform. Mac os x includes a commandline ssh client as part of the operating system. Openssh encrypts all traffic including passwords to effectively eliminate eavesdropping, connection hijacking, and other attacks. Ssh clients for windows and mac software licensing. The code handles the layer 2 udp connection and mndp discovery portion of the mactelnet protocol to allow tunneling ssh connections to an ssh enabled. Terminus is a highly configurable terminal emulator for windows, macos and linux.
How can i easily mount a windows share from my mac. Connecting from unixlike environment linux, mac os x, cygwin. Whether you are running windows or mac, ssh can easily be integrated into the system. The client will wait idle for 60 seconds serveraliveinterval time and, send a noop null packet to the server and expect a response. The software integrates all those emulations and advanced features that let the users access hosts and mainframes through a secure shell, serial cable, telnet, modem, and other prevailing methods of interactions. If you actually want to do it the unixlinux way, you need to install gitbash, mingw or somethig similar. Connecting to your linux instance using ssh amazon. Cygwin generally used to run linux tools like ssh,scp,bash, x11,gcc in. Putty for mac is a port of the windows version of putty. These days, a full 32 bit cygwin distro is not feasible anymore, and will in all likelihood fail in random places due to an issue with the fork2 system call. To enable the vnc server, select remote management and then press computer settings. It is intended to supplement mingw and the deficiencies of the cmd shell. Mingw compilers provide access to the functionality of the microsoft c runtime and some languagespecific runtimes. If you use linux at work, and windows at home, or vice versa, you might at times need to log in to the computer at your other location, and run programs.
Windowstomac remote management with vnc and ssh 4sysops. Recent versions of windows server 2019 and windows 10 openssh is included as an installable component. It definitely runs on mac as well as windows, so its another option. When your build script runs an ssh client, it uses the ssh agent with the loaded key. Mingw, being minimalist, does not, and never will, attempt to provide a posix runtime environment for posix application deployment on mswindows. The correct steps prior to the ssh commands themselves, are. Openssh for mac os x installation, how to and custom. The code handles the layer 2 udp connection and mndp discovery portion of the mactelnet protocol to allow tunneling ssh connections to an ssh enabled mactelnet. If your compute doesnt recognize the command, you can install an ssh client. If the server still doesnt respond, then the client disconnects the ssh connection. If you want to run a linux or mac x application remotely on your windows machine, you will need two pieces of software on your windows box. The default ciphers in your mac ssh client are not the entire list of ciphers supported. Openssh is a free version of the ssh connectivity tools that technical users of the internet rely on. Here we present top 5 ssh clients for mac os x and windows.
Generating a new ssh key and adding it to the sshagent github. When adding your ssh key to the agent, use the default macos sshadd. Here s a list of 7 free putty alternatives for mac to create ssh connections in 2019. Msys2 is a software distro and building platform for windows. Sorry my copypasting and numbering leaves a lot to be desired. This is a mac ssh client for windows based on mac telnet from aouyar ali onur uyar which is an ssh enabled version of the original mac telnet implementation from haakonnessjoen hakon nessjoen. Windows 10 now includes both ssh client and server. A secure shell ssh client is software that uses the ssh cryptographic protocol to enable users to connect to other computers, primarily to transfer files and for terminal access. Connecting from unixlike environment linux, mac os x, cygwin mingw this short tutorial describes how to connect to a ceci cluster from a terminal application, such as xterm, gnome terminal, konsole, iterm, linux running on windows subsytem for linux, etc choose your favorite terminal application to follow the steps below. Script to install a mingww64 crosscompiler suite on mac. Top five ssh clients for windows and mac prolimehost blog. Ssh is an integral tool you need to access servers, switches, and routers among other network systems.
10 688 1625 458 1194 266 259 638 310 1203 102 1485 739 95 167 1487 34 1560 1081 1322 194 204 889 1504 1423 16 1036 626 67 417 396 307 706 1239 1107 1307 1345 633 1248 100 1022 1303